Same cuemaker made the best and worst hitting cues I've played with, Bill Schick. His regular high end cues all seemed to have big butts and just felt funny but the sneaky pete I had for years played fantastic until it was stolen. The workmanship on his cues is incredible.

Changing shafts can make all the difference on a cue IMO. The taper, ferrule, tips, joints etc... all change the way a cue hits. I've played with cues that played like crap, changed the shaft and it felt great.
